The onsite spa has 2 treatment rooms including rooms for couples. Services include deep-tissue massages, sports massages, facials, and body wraps. A variety of treatment therapies are provided, including aromatherapy and reflexology. The spa is equipped with a sauna and a steam room.
The spa is open daily. Children under 12 years old are not allowed in the spa without adult supervision.
